
Leone Nakarawa
Leone Nakarawa is a Fijian rugby player celebrated for his skills as a lock and his exceptional offloading ability, which has made him a standout player in international and club rugby. He has played for top teams like Glasgow Warriors and has represented Fiji in several World Cups.
